1. What are the regulatory authorities with jurisdiction over drugs, biologicals, and medical devices in your country? The Authority that regulates drugs, biologicals and medical devices in Panama is the Ministry of Health through the following authorities:  Pharmaceutical and Drug Department   Medical Devices National Department   Bioethical National Committee. Which are the main actors involved in public procurement and tendering? In Saudi Arabia, the main actors in the public procurement and tendering process for pharmaceuticals include: NUPCO (National Unified Procurement Company): Acts as the central purchasing agent for the Ministry of Health (MOH), Ministry of Defense, National Guard, and universities. Are there any Managed entry agreements in place in your country? (If so, please list them) Yes, Saudi Arabia has implemented two types of Managed Entry Agreements (MEAs) under the Ministry of Health’s “Managed-Entry Agreement Policy” issued in January 2021. Please describe the main cost containment policies in place in your country and their fundamental principles   a. Pricing and impact of generic/biosimilar approval The SFDA applies automatic price reductions for generics and biosimilars: The 1st generic is priced ≥35% lower than the originator. Which are the administrations, bodies and institutions in charge of public health in your country and what are their respective responsibilities? The Ministry of Health (MOH) is the primary body responsible for public health in Saudi Arabia.
